Island Health and the CRD have just lifted an earlier swimming advisory for Hamsterly Beach at Elk Lake.
Earlier this week, authorities advised beach goers to avoid swimming in the lake, particularly at Hamsterly beach and Eagle beach, due to an unsafe amount of bacteria in the water.

Sampling results at Hamsterly beach show bacteriological counts below acceptable limits in the water, and the beach is therefore considered safe for swimming.
However, the advisory remains in place for Eagle beach at this time as water samples from that area show high levels of bacteria.
“As a precautionary measure, it is NOT recommended for people or pets to enter the water at Eagle Beach,” reads a statement.
